Subject: [PATCH] mtd: rawnand: marvell: Use nand_cleanup() when the device is not yet registered
Git-commit: 7a0c18fb5c71c6ac7d4662a145e4227dcd4a36a3
Patch-mainline: v5.8-rc1
References: git-fixes

Do not call nand_release() while the MTD device has not been
registered, use nand_cleanup() instead.
